Arduino传感器信号不稳?可能是缺了这个RC滤波电路!从原理到代码的避坑指南
2026/6/13 3:31:52
制作一个面向初学者的client_plugin_auth教学材料,要求:1. 用流程图展示认证过程 2. 对比不同认证方式的区别(JWT vs Session等) 3. 提供5个常见错误示例及解决方法 4. 包含简单的实践练习 5. 使用生动形象的类比解释技术概念。输出格式为Markdown,适合新手阅读。在开发过程中,经常会遇到client_plugin_auth is required这样的提示,这通常意味着你的请求缺少了必要的认证信息。对于刚入门的新手来说,认证机制可能是一个比较抽象的概念。本文会用通俗易懂的方式,带你理解client_plugin_auth的核心逻辑,并通过图解和类比帮助你快速掌握API认证的基础知识。
简单来说,client_plugin_auth是一种客户端插件认证机制,用于验证请求的合法性。就像进入公司大楼需要刷卡一样,客户端在访问某些API时,也需要提供有效的认证信息(比如Token、密钥等),否则服务器会拒绝请求并返回类似client_plugin_auth is required的错误。
认证过程可以类比为去银行办理业务:
client_plugin_auth is required解决:检查请求头是否包含Authorization字段或相应认证参数。
错误:Token过期
Token expired解决:重新获取有效Token并更新请求。
错误:权限不足
403 Forbidden解决:确认当前Token是否具备访问该资源的权限。
错误:认证方式不匹配
Unsupported authentication type解决:检查服务器支持的认证方式(如Basic Auth/OAuth2)。
错误:密钥配置错误
Invalid API key尝试用InsCode快速体验认证流程:
Authorization: Bearer your_token通过InsCode的一键部署功能,你可以快速将包含认证机制的项目部署到线上,实时验证学习效果。这个平台对新手特别友好,不需要配置复杂环境就能看到实际运行效果,建议动手试试看!
制作一个面向初学者的client_plugin_auth教学材料,要求:1. 用流程图展示认证过程 2. 对比不同认证方式的区别(JWT vs Session等) 3. 提供5个常见错误示例及解决方法 4. 包含简单的实践练习 5. 使用生动形象的类比解释技术概念。输出格式为Markdown,适合新手阅读。创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考